Retina
The light-sensitive layer of tissue located at the back of the eye, which is responsible for converting light into neural signals for vision.
Fovea
Fovea is a small depression in the retina of the eye where visual acuity is highest, due to the concentration of cone cells.
Rods
Photoreceptor cells in the retina of the eye that are sensitive to low light levels and are primarily responsible for night vision.
